




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、10.9.8軟件開發方案所有的項目軟件開發過程都應遵循一個生命周期模型,在軟件的開發策劃期間,需要仔細考慮項目的特征和目標,然后選擇生命周期模型。在本項目中,本投標單位將選用常用的瀑布型生命周期模型。瀑布模型的主要特點是:只有當一個階段的文檔已編制好,且該階段的產品得到質量保證人員(SQA)認可后,該階段才算完成。測試或驗證在每個階段都必須執行;一旦產品完成提交用戶,其后的任何修改均屬于維護階段。在瀑布型模型中,主要定義的過程包括:需求分析、系統分析、代碼實現、測試。l 需求分析需求分析的目的是通過調查和分析,獲取用戶需求并定義產品需求。需求分析的輸出文檔是需求分析說明書(RAS)。需求分析說
2、明書(RAS)將用客戶語言來描述系統需求,其主要的目的是作為與用戶溝通并達成一致的基礎。這些需求需要用戶參與進行評審,并得到用戶的確認。然后對用戶需求進行細化,對比較復雜的用戶需求進行建模分析,最終形成面向軟件產品的軟件需求說明。需求分析的主要任務包括:Ø 確定需求調查的方式,例如問卷式、面對面談等;Ø 調查與記錄;Ø 分析需求信息;Ø 編寫需求分析說明書(RAS);Ø 組織需求分析說明書(RAS)評審。主要的角色與職責為:Ø 系統分析員,調查和分析用戶需求;Ø 客戶與最終用戶提供必要的需求信息,并確認客戶需求;Ø
3、 系統分析員定義產品軟件需求;Ø 客戶與最終用戶提供必要的信息,并確認產品需求。l 系統設計系統設計是指設計軟件系統的體系架構、用戶界面、數據庫、模塊等,從而在需求和代碼實現之間建立橋梁,指導開發人員去實現能滿足用戶需求的軟件產品。系統設計可分為兩個階段:概要設計和詳細設計。概要設計的要點是體系架構的設計,詳細設計的重點是用戶界面設計、數據庫設計以及模塊的設計。主要的輸出文檔包括:系統總體設計報告。 主要的參與人員包括:Ø 項目經理指定具備相關經驗的開發人員進行軟件系統架構的設計,這些開發人員又稱為體系架構設計人員;Ø 在用戶界面的設計中,常常需要美工和用戶的參與
4、;Ø 項目經理指定開發人員進行數據庫、模塊的設計。系統設計的主要任務包括:Ø 設計準備,包括閱讀前一階段的文檔等;Ø 設計,不同的設計內容所采用的方法有所不同,例如對于用戶界面的設計,一般采用“原型創作-原型評估-細化”的步驟或方法;Ø 編寫相關的設計文檔;Ø 組織設計評審。l 開發(代碼實現) 開發也稱為代碼實現,其主要的任務為編寫整個系統的代碼,并進行單元的測試。本過程的輸入是個設計文檔,輸出是源代碼、單元測試記錄以及代碼審查記錄。其主要工作任務包括:Ø 準備-確定代碼規范等標準、準備軟件開發環境等;Ø 代碼實現-代碼的
5、編寫;Ø 代碼審查-依據代碼規范,進行代碼的審查,包括開發人員的互查項目經理的同行評審;Ø 單元測試-采用互測方式進行。l 測試測試包括集成測試、系統測試和用戶驗收測試。集成測試側重于模塊的集成,是子系統/模塊一級的測試。系統測試是針對最終軟件系統進行,是一次全面的測試,需要確保軟件系統滿足產品需求并遵循系統設計。所以系統測試控制的一個關鍵點是測試的覆蓋率。驗收測試一般由用戶組織,屬于用戶對系統的符合性、正確性進行驗證的測試。測試的主要任務包括:Ø 制定測試計劃-當產品需求和系統設計文檔完成之后,測試小組就可以開始制定測試計劃和測試用例了。測試計劃的主要內容包括:
6、測試完成準則、測試范圍、測試方法、人員、測試環境與輔助工具、進度;Ø 設計測試用例-有測試人員完成其設計和編寫工作,并需要通過評審;Ø 測試實施-依據計劃和測試用例進行測試,測試中發現的錯誤,要求及時記錄,將錯誤及時通知開發人員并使測試人員可以跟蹤錯誤直到錯誤問題解決關閉;Ø 錯誤管理與改錯-任何人發現的錯誤,將被記錄,開發人員及時消除錯誤,在開發人員消除錯誤之后立即進行回歸測試,以確保不會引入新的錯誤;Ø 測試報告-對于系統測試盒驗收測試,在測試完畢后需要進行總結并形成報告。Ø 本投標人的產品測試獨立于產品的開發,在產品單元測試完成之后,即交
7、付專門的測試部門進行后續測試,獨立開發的測試機制進一步保證了測試的有效性和完整性。l 版本控制控制的目的是保存產品的所有版本,避免發生版本的丟失混淆等現象。并且可以快速準確地查找到任何產品的任何版本。控制的范圍是項目中的所有產品,從需求文檔、設計文檔、測試文檔、用戶手冊到源代碼。在人員參與度方面,將是所有的項目成員都必須遵照版本控制規程操作文檔庫。控制的要點包括:Ø 在項目的策劃階段,編寫配置管理計劃。在計劃中將指定人員作為配置管理員,負責整個項目的版本控制,變更控制等。計劃中還需要標識配置項作為版本控制的基本對象;Ø 配置服務器作為配置庫服務器,集中存放項目的所有已完成產
8、品;Ø 使用配置管理工具實施管理控制;Ø 針對產品的不同狀態,實施不同的控制策略,例如基線狀態的產品,其變更要求有嚴格的申請、評估、審批、實施、驗證、提交過程;10.9.9軟件實施安排為保證項目在規定的時間內順利完成,軟件項目管理工作對本系統的實施極其重要。本投標人將在軟件項目管理總體上貫徹工程的思想,并在項目組織實施中抓住關鍵工序,采用一系列措施和辦法。l 軟件管理總體框架l 軟件管理的階段本次項目基于GIS系統是一個包括軟件和部分硬件相結合的系統集成類工作,從系統集成的角度,我們對該部分項目管理主要分為如下9個階段:Ø 工程的準備;Ø 工程的確定;&
9、#216; 工程設備采購、軟件開發;Ø 工程設備安裝、單項調試和驗收;Ø 聯合測試、試運行階段;Ø 項目驗收;Ø 培訓;Ø 運行的管理和維護;Ø 售后服務與系統的安全保障。各階段邏輯順序關系如下圖所示:l 各個階段的主要工作以下是各個階段的工作時間內容具體說明。1)系統工程的準備階段:該階段主要工作是對系統工程進行系統分析和深化設計、準備系統接口技術要求文件。具體包括如下內容:按照相關標準規范,根據系統項目的實際情況確定系統需求,完成并提交相關文檔;明確系統工程的信息流程和管理模式;確定系統相關的數據、界面接口協議,包括采用的操作系統
10、、硬件接口、連接方式、通訊方式、網絡協議、數據記錄格式、應答方式、網絡故障時的自救方法、進度安排、測試標準等;利用最精簡的設備,搭建模擬環境,為系統檢測和發布相關設備的初步驗收和測試做好實驗準備;從技術角度,對主要設備供應商的技術要求提出明確意見或建議;對系統工程進行深化設計并提出詳細的技術實施方案;制定行之有效的工程實施計劃;與設備供應商等進行總進度計劃協調。2)系統工程的確定階段:該階段主要是根據系統工程的總體安排,確定設備供應商等的工作范圍、責任、相互關系等。從技術角度,確定設備供應商的工作內容;業主、系統集成商、設備供應商一起確定系統各子系統之間的接口標準、規范、實施方法以及相互責任。
11、包括各自相關的工作內容、質量控制、變更管理、各方責任、工程進度安排、測試標準、聯調開通等。3)系統工程的設備采購、軟件開發階段:該階段本投標人、設備供應商等按照合同要求進行設備采購供應、軟件開發項目實施等工作。所有主要設備都需要在貨物到達后由本投標人進行測試,符合標準和規范,才能送往現場安裝,并提交相應的設備測試報告。通過確定階段對系統軟件總體需求的理解,進行軟件實際開發階段。4)系統設備安裝、單項調試和驗收、模擬聯合測試階段:該階段有本投標人、設備供應商等按照有關要求進行設備的安裝、單項調試和驗收,模擬聯合測試。設備安裝工程中,本投標人將根據需要向業主提出工程實施階段性驗收。本投標人將按照規
12、定的實施進度,確認個部分工程系統的進度,提交合格的各項驗收測試報告給業主,對存在的問題,與業主技術協調處理。建立系統集成模擬聯合測試環境,組織設備的模擬聯合測試。設備供應商提供有關測試、驗收的工作程序及方式給業主、本投標人,經批準后進行有關工作。設備在測試驗收時,本投標人和設備供應商提供所需的、標準的測試儀器、儀表。5)聯合測試、試運行階段:該階段由本投標人負責,業主統一協調、進行功能集成、聯合測試,通過后進入試運行階段。本投標人將協調、組織相關設備供應商,負責建立功能完善的集成系統。本投標人將制定整個系統運行的方案和工作程序(包括調試運行周期),并成交業主。本投標人將提供試運行方案給業主,協
13、調、組織有關方面,開始試運行工作。6)系統驗收階段:該階段由業主和本投標人統一協調,組織進行驗收。驗收包括:預驗、初驗和最終驗收。本投標人在系統試運行和聯網運行驗收通過后,將向業主提出正式驗收申請。驗收標準將依據有關國際標準、中國國家標準規范、系統設計和招標文件的要求。驗收內容至少包括以下各項:安裝設備的數量、型號和規格;完整的竣工驗收資料圖紙;設備安裝、調試的特殊工具;系統功能;系統質量。7)系統培訓:本投標人將對業主指派的人員進行培訓,培訓內容包括理論將結合實際操作。培訓開始之前本投標人將提出培訓計劃(包括:內容、技術資料 、時間、地點、人數等),撰寫培訓教材,由業主確認后在實施培訓。本投
14、標人將負責使接受培訓的人員達到能正確操作和維護的上崗資格。8)系統運行的管理和維護:從系統驗收通過之日起,系統進入質保期,項目質保期為36個月。在此期間,本投標人將派駐專業工程師在項目現場,保障系統的正常運行并隨時解決出現的問題。在質量保證期內,對任何因安裝工藝、材料和產品質量而造成的設備或部件的損壞,本投標人將提供無常的更換和維修。在質量保證期內,本投標人將負責系統維護、確保系統維護及時、高效。如果在質保期內,國家、公安部或交通部門頒布了有關交通管理的接口標準,本投標人將無條件免費按照國標或部標,更換所提供給采購人的軟件系統滿足國標或部標的接入標準。9)售后服務:產品實行終身維護。本投標單位在濰坊具有指定專業維護機構,具備常住維修人員6名和相關維修設備和車輛(工程高車及售后服務車)。具有良好的售后服務、質量保證體
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 量子力學原理入門:大學物理實驗課程教案
- 高純石英砂生產線項目可行性研究報告(參考范文)
- 2025年心理學中級職稱考試試題及答案
- 2025年行政職業能力測驗試題及答案
- 2025年天文學基礎知識測試試卷及答案
- 2025年勝任力與職業發展考試試題及答案
- 2025年農業推廣師職業考試試卷及答案
- 2025年經濟政策分析與評估測試卷及答案
- 2025年國際關系理論相關考試試題及答案
- 2025年公共衛生政策與管理考試試題及答案
- 醫藥代表聘用合同模板
- 2024-2030年中國公路工程行業市場發展分析及前景預判與投資研究報告
- 2.4圓周角(第1課時)(課件)九年級數學上冊(蘇科版)
- 桿塔組立施工安全檢查表
- DL∕T 1392-2014 直流電源系統絕緣監測裝置技術條件
- 2024年山東省高中學業水平合格考生物試卷試題(含答案詳解)
- 電影敘事與美學智慧樹知到期末考試答案章節答案2024年南開大學
- YYT 0663.3-2016 心血管植入物 血管內器械 第3部分:腔靜脈濾器
- 【專業版】短視頻直播電商部門崗位職責及績效考核指標管理實施辦法
- SOHO-VD 收獲變頻器手冊
- 富血小板血漿(PRP)簡介
評論
0/150
提交評論